Building Division Promotes Apprentice Program at Palm Beach State College

 

On April 25, 2024, Building Division (Division) representatives from the Palm Beach County's Planning, Zoning and Building Department spoke to over 38 students at Palm Beach State College in Lake Worth enrolled in the constructions services program.  

 

Building Coordinator Michael Gauger, Plans Examiner Richie Rosales and Inspections Apprentices Skyler Foley and Sarrah Turba provided insight on career opportunities available in the building safety industry, including within the Division.  

 

They also discussed the Division's 4-year Apprenticeship Program where candidates receive paid training and mentoring to obtain state licenses for plans examiners or inspectors for trades of structural, electrical, plumbing, and mechanical disciplines.

 

PBSC Business and Community Relations Director Matthew Lenihan said, “The students thoroughly enjoyed the presentation, and many are very interested in pursuing the next steps for the Apprentice program. What an awesome opportunity and hopefully a sign of more collaboration to come."

 

Available positions in the Apprenticeship Program are advertised the county's website.  Applicants must have a high school diploma or equivalent and be able to obtain a Florida driver's license within 60 days.  Once accepted into the program, apprentices obtain hands-on “real world" experience while they learn technical aspects of plan review or inspections.  Successful apprentices become proficient at reading construction plans and documents and acquire a complete working knowledge of the Florida Building Code, and related applicable codes and regulations to prepare them to test for licensure.
